Java特殊符号与语法详解

需积分: 50 1 下载量 16 浏览量 更新于2024-08-18 收藏 2.75MB PPT 举报
"Java是一种广泛使用的面向对象的编程语言,其语法规范中包含了各种特殊符号。本文主要关注Java中的特殊符号及其用途,同时也概述了Java的学习路径和核心知识点。 Java的注释系统对于代码的可读性和文档化至关重要。单行注释以两个斜线(//)开始,用于在一行内添加解释。多行注释则用/* 开始并以 */ 结束,可以在多行中提供描述。此外,还有一种特殊的多行注释,即Javadoc样式(/**…*/),这种注释可以被Java的javadoc工具提取,生成API文档,使得其他人无需查看源代码也能理解代码功能。 特殊符号在Java语法中起到关键作用。分号(;)是语句的终止符,表明一个操作或声明的结束。大括号 ({ 和 }) 用于创建代码块,通常用于控制流程或封装类、方法和接口的定义。空白字符,包括空格、制表符、回车和换行符,用于增强代码的可读性,它们在代码中起着间隔和对齐的作用。 Java的学习通常分为多个阶段。首先,Java语法基础涵盖了变量、数据类型、运算符、控制流(如条件语句和循环)以及数组的使用。接下来,深入到面向对象编程,学习如何定义类、对象,理解封装、继承和多态的概念。在Java的高级部分,包括图形用户界面(GUI)编程,这涉及到使用AWT或Swing库创建桌面应用的界面。多线程编程允许并发执行任务,提高程序效率。I/O编程涉及文件操作和数据流的处理,而网络编程则让Java程序能够进行网络通信。 Java平台的安全性是其重要特性之一,它通过字节码验证和垃圾收集机制来确保代码的安全执行。Java平台上实现代码安全的方法包括沙箱模型、权限管理等。在开发环境中,开发者需要安装JDK,搭建开发环境,并学会使用javac编译器将源代码编译成字节码,最后通过java命令运行程序。 核心Java课程通常包括: 1. Java语言基础:理解基本语法,包括标识符、关键字和数据类型。 2. 表达式和流程控制:学习算术、逻辑和比较运算符,以及if、switch、for、while等控制结构。 3. 数组:掌握数组的声明、初始化和操作。 4. 面向对象编程:深入探讨类、对象、包、Applets和应用程序的创建。 5. 高级语言特性:异常处理、图形GUI、多线程和网络编程。 6. AWT和Swing:构建GUI组件,理解和使用事件模型。 7. I/O和文件处理:学习输入/输出流,包括文件读写。 8. 网络编程:涉及套接字编程和其他网络通信技术。 通过这些课程的学习,开发者可以逐步掌握Java编程的全面技能,从而能够在各种应用场景中编写高效、可靠的代码。"